Rent Inflation in Kansas City, MO
The average asking rent in Kansas City, MO is $1,548/month as of 2026-05. That is +3.5% compared to a year ago.
Source: Zillow Observed Rent Index (ZORI) | zillow.com/research

Why Rent Inflation Matters
Shelter is the single largest component of the official CPI, accounting for roughly one-third of the index. But the BLS shelter index tends to lag real-market rent changes by 12–18 months because it measures rents paid by all tenants — including long-term renters locked into old leases. ZORI measures asking rents for new leases, making it a timelier signal of where CPI shelter inflation is headed.
When ZORI is rising sharply in your city, it is a leading indicator that official shelter inflation — and therefore overall CPI — will remain elevated in coming months.

Data Source
Rent data uses the Zillow Observed Rent Index (ZORI), a smoothed measure of typical market-rate asking rents updated monthly by Zillow Research. ZORI covers single-family homes, condos, and co-ops and reflects asking rents for new leases — making it a more timely indicator than the lagged BLS shelter index. zillow.com/research | Money & Prices
